Three additional names were attributed to Agrisius. A. plumbeonigra Swinhoe, 1916 (Ann. Mag. Nat. Hist. (8) 18: 485) from Khasi Hills in Meghalaya, India; this name is probably a synonym of Baroa punctivaga (Walker, 1855). LepIndex (http://www.nhm.ac.uk/research-curation/research/projects/lepindex/) cited two names in Agrisius that were described as A. griseilinea de Joannis, 1930; Ann. Soc. Ent. Fr. 98: 756-757, and A. strigibasis de Joannis, 1930; Ann. Soc. Ent. Fr. 98: 757-758, both from Cha pa (=Sa Pa), North Vietnam. However, such combinations are mistakes, because these names were described in another genera. The former has a mistake in a genus name abbreviation and should be read as Cyana, the second one was described in Asura. - V.V.Dubatolov, September, 8, 2012.
